Abstract

A novel display apparatus is provided. The display apparatus includes a first layer including a plurality of pixel circuits, a second layer provided over the first layer, a plurality of optical lenses provided over the second layer, a display region, and a plurality of light-receiving regions. The display region includes a first pixel circuit provided in the first layer and a light-emitting device provided in the second layer. The light-receiving region includes a second pixel circuit provided in the first layer and a light-receiving device provided in the second layer. The plurality of light-receiving regions are provided around the display region. The optical lens is provided at a position overlapping with the light-receiving region.
